What is a Lithium Battery Electric Valve?

A Lithium Battery Electric Valve is a type of valve used in automated systems that can be remotely controlled via electric actuators powered by lithium-ion batteries. Unlike traditional valves, which may require external power sources or complex piping and mechanical components, these electric valves operate using an internal lithium battery, making them ideal for locations where external power is unavailable or unreliable.
